Recognizing Bail and Its Objective
The lawful system can be complex, understanding Bail and its objective is necessary for people traversing criminal fees. Bail functions as a system to guarantee that accuseds show up in court while enabling them to keep their flexibility throughout the lawful process. By posting Bail, a charged person can prevent pre-trial detention, which can be economically and mentally straining. The amount set for Bail is generally figured out by a court, taking into consideration variables such as the intensity of the crime, the defendant's criminal background, and the probability of taking off. Eventually, Bail aims to balance the civil liberties of the accused with the passions of public safety and security and the judicial procedure, guaranteeing liability while maintaining individual freedoms till a decision is reached.
Just How Bail Bond Services Work
Bail bond solutions play a necessary role in the Bail procedure for those not able to pay for the complete Bail amount set by the court. When a person is arrested, the court establishes a bail quantity based on the severity of the fees and the person's flight danger. If the implicated can not pay this quantity, they can seek assistance from a bail bondsman. The bail bondsman typically bills a percent of the total Bail as a cost and uses to cover the continuing to be amount. In return, the accused have to agree to certain problems, consisting of appearing in court as called for. This system allows individuals to secure their launch while waiting for test, ensuring they preserve their liberty and proceed with their lives.
The Financial Aspects of Bail Bonds
Expense of Bail Bonds
Comprehending the expense of Bail bonds is essential for people going across the criminal justice system, as these costs can considerably impact financial security. Normally, bail bond service fee a costs, commonly around 10% of the total Bail quantity set by the court. This charge is non-refundable, despite the instance's outcome. Extra prices may arise, such as management costs or collateral needs, depending upon the bond's specifics. The financial concern of protecting a bond can be substantial, especially for those with restricted resources. People should examine their monetary circumstance thoroughly, as the obligations linked with Bail bonds can lead to more financial pressure if not taken care of correctly. Understanding these prices is crucial for educated decision-making.

Alternatives to Bail Bond Services
The complexities surrounding Bail have actually triggered discussions regarding alternatives to standard bail bond solutions. One noteworthy option is using pretrial release programs, which enable offenders to continue to be totally free while awaiting trial under specific problems. These programs typically involve regular check-ins with a supervising police officer. Furthermore, some territories have implemented risk evaluation devices to examine a defendant's probability of reoffending, allowing judges to make enlightened launch decisions without requiring Bail. Another alternative consists of release on recognizance, where people assure to appear in court without the requirement for financial Bail. Community support programs likewise play a duty, providing resources to assist offenders fulfill court requirements. These options aim to decrease the financial worry on individuals and enhance overall justice outcomes.

Frequently Asked Inquiries
What Happens if the Charged Falls Short to Appear in Court?
If the charged stops working to appear in court, a warrant might be provided for their arrest. Additionally, any kind of Bail posted might be waived, causing punitive damages for the bail bond solution and the charged.
Can Bail Bond Services Be Used for Any Type Of Kind Of Violation?
Bail bond solutions are normally applicable to various offenses, including felonies and misdemeanors. However, particular major charges, such as funding offenses or those without Bail option, may limit their use, limiting availability for certain circumstances.
The length of time Does the Bail Bond Refine Typically Take?
The bail bond process normally takes a few hours to a day, depending upon the intricacy of the situation and the accessibility of the needed documents. Aspects like territory and court routines can affect this timeline.
Are Bail Bond Charges Refundable After Court Process?
Bail bond costs are usually taken into consideration non-refundable, as they compensate the bond representative for their solutions. Also if the offender is acquitted, the fees usually stay with the bonding business, showing the threat included.
